Lucas Torreira: Why I left Arsenal for Fiorentina

Arsenal midfielder Lucas Torreira has explained his move to Fiorentina.

The Uruguay international has joined the Viola on a season-long loan. Torreira spent the previous campaign in a similar deal with Atletico Madrid, though struggled for minutes during their successful run to the LaLiga title.

Now with Fiorentina, Torreira admits part of the motivation for the move was next year's World Cup after losing his place in the Uruguay squad in recent months.

"I want to play as much as possible and help Fiorentina this season. We must continue like this. Now I will continue with a great desire to work, grow and make myself available to the coach," he told Teledoce via Fotboll Transfers.

"At Arsenal, I've lacked a bit of continuity lately, which also cost me the call to Uruguay's national team in the last part of the World Cup qualifiers."

Despite missing those ties, Torreira could see the bright side as it gave him the chance of a full preseason and to work with Fiorentina coach Vincenzo Italiano.

He added: "Maybe it was better this way because I had more time to work in Fiorentina and fit into the coach's plans."

Torreira's deal with the Viola includes a permanent option. His contract with Arsenal runs to 2025. So far this term, Torreira has made two appearances for his loan club.
